Golden Bride is a television series[1]. It ranks in the top 10% of television_series ent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(35 views/month).[2]

- Golden Bride's instance of is recorded as television series[3].
- Golden Bride's genre is recorded as drama television series[4].
- Golden Bride's follows is recorded as Yeon Gaesomun[5].
- Golden Bride's followed by is recorded as I Am Happy[6].
- Golden Bride's original language of film or TV show is recorded as Korean[7].
- Golden Bride's original broadcaster is recorded as Seoul Broadcasting System[8].
- Golden Bride's country of origin is recorded as South Korea[9].
- Golden Bride's start time is recorded as +2007-06-23T00:00:00Z[10].
- Golden Bride's end time is recorded as +2008-02-03T00:00:00Z[11].
- Golden Bride's Freebase ID is recorded as /m/05zk1lh[12].
- Golden Bride's number of episodes is recorded as {'amount': '+64'}[13].
